Some conversations don’t just inform; they expand your perspective. This episode with Mr. Avishek Nag is one of those.

Avishek is a data scientist with over 17 years of experience in the software industry, a published author of three technical books, and a self-taught visual artist who brings old, forgotten structures to life with ink and colour pencils. A rare mix of analytical precision and creative expression.

What began as a conversation on machine learning, AI, and Python unfolded into something much deeper, reflections on how technology is shaping human thinking, the fading patience in a world of instant results, and the quiet satisfaction of drawing with a fountain pen.

Watch the full episode here:

In this episode, we spoke about:

1. The fundamentals of AI, ML, and how they’re often misunderstood
2. His book Stochastic Finance with Python and the practical side of statistical modeling
3. Why over-reliance on generative AI might slowly erode our cognitive skills
4. His journey from painting as a child to exhibiting as a professional artist

This is an episode that moves seamlessly between the world of data and the world of emotion. Between what we automate and what we still need to feel. Avishek reminds us that even in a world driven by code, there’s room, and need for creativity, depth, and reflection.
